Hey yall!

Hope everyone is still doing good and healthy. We made a trip down to a local creek to do a little fishing. Wading creeks is probably my favorite way to fish just because you never know what you might catch...and today didn't disappoint. We caught some bass, bream, trout and a couple other species!

We go over some of the tactics we use when fishing in creeks to help anyone that may be new to creek fishing. It's a little different from just fishing in a lake because the current is really the main factor when trying to find fish. If you can find slack water behind rocks or other obstructions that's what you'll want to fish because the predatory fish will be holding their waiting for bait to flow on by. We go over most of the tips in the vid but feel free to ask any questions and I'll try to help you out!

Nice video. Beautiful stream. What state? Clearly not anywhere in(or close) to Texas. I have canoe/kayak fished many rivers in Texas. Llano, Perdanales, Devils, Pecos, Brazos, S. Llano, Guadalupe......and many in Oklahoma, Missouri and Arkansas. The 3”-4” chartreuse curly tailed grub on a 1/8-1/4oz jig head is my absolute go to bait on all these rivers. They will hit other baits but if they aren’t bitting the grub....they are not biting!
